Koperasi Karyawan Mitra Usaha Dinamika or Employees Cooperative Business Partners Dynamics or what we know as (KOMUNIKA) is a legal entity owned by our joint cooperation, employees of P.T. Bakrie Telecom Tbk, who obtained a deed of ratification of the law in January 2006. Previous cooperative employees we are still under the name P.T. Ratelindo which then had a business license is limited to all business activities and savings and loans that are no longer operating as a company name change.

 

KOMUNIKA has been in operation since November 2007 in various business activities, with the aim of assisting the all employee of P.T. BAKRIE TELECOM Tbk and P.T. BAKRIE CONNECTIVITY in raising funds for the welfare of all employees.

 

Beginning with the activities of education and socialization of the vision, mission and work program periodically to its members. Some business activities KOMUNIKA began to receive positive responses such mandatory programs as well as the principal savings and loan programs that can be enjoyed by employees who have registered as a member. Membership cooperatives which in principle are voluntary (optional) as a stimulus for efforts to create a loan program with attractive facilities so that the year was less than 350 employees have signed up for membership. This marks a good start for going-concern KOMUNIKA.

 

In 2008 KOMUNIKA began spreading its wings by acquiring multiple lines of business such as licensing and permit the Export-Import, single distributor, dealership, General Contractor & Trading, Rental Land & Buildings, Transportation, Outsourcing and others are certainly more complete permit the main Komunika savings and loans, Financial Services, Investment and Financing Services. With consciousness as a relatively new entity, MUSIC have much to learn from other similar cooperatives, then in 2009 KOMUNIKA begin to open ourselves to the external environment, among others, joined the Parent Cooperative Bakrie (INKOPBA) a holding cooperative that houses at least 23 units of Cooperative which are in an environment Bakrie Group, build synergies and strategic alliances with cooperatives of five major telecommunications operators in Indonesia Joint Cooperative Telecommunications Operator (GK-OTI), open access facilities, information, guidance and other institutions through the Cooperative Council of Indonesia (DEKOPIN), Ministry of Cooperatives and SMEs and Small Medium Entreprise institution Company (SMESCO).

 

The combination of internal and external conditions above are slowly making KOMUNIKA gained the confidence to contribute to the company's business with the importers, distributors and handset sales administration, and wifone Wimode, became manager layananan Call Centre with access code 14090 for Sriwijaya Air ticket reservation, and the CPE Dealer for Cooperatives and SMEs. KOMUNIKA gradually also provide improved services to members through the activities of service business deposits (Principal, mandatory and Taperum), loan and finance employees / members such as the KTA and will soon be introduced KKB service programs, mortgage and KPA, scholarships and ONH for increase the common welfare.

 

Management and development of business activities require the support and trust KOMUNIKA entire management and all employees / members to become members of the dual benefits of our Community, that is as user where we can obtain financing services that are lighter and more profitable, and as the owner where we are entitled to the benefit of SHU or dividends from the participation of members and business profit KOMUNIKA periodically, can be stronger. In 2010 and future years, may continue to grow KOMUNIKA achieve the vision and mission to provide significant benefits and long-term for the Company, employees and their families.

 

In the process of achievement necessary leadership skills, entrepreneurship spirit, commitment, hard work and cooperation of stakeholders and shareholders. It is also necessary repairs and improvements on all sides including the transformation of leadership KOMUNIKA by style into by the system and its patterns of regeneration and regeneration, improvement of the system, coordination and organization, improving facilities and supporting prasanara to become an independent entity, professional and transparent. KOMUNIKA provides services in tour and traveling, ticketing, hotel reservation, tour domestic and international, car rental services, etc. Mr. Ari, legal section devision staff of KOMUNIKA explained the company is also import of telecommunication equipment and mobile cellular phone with HUAWEI TECH brand of China. The whole mobile phone sold by parent company P.T. BAKRIE TELECOM Tbk and also through other dealer and shops.

 

We observe the operation of KOMUNIKA has been growing and developing well in the last three years. Until this time KOMUNIKA has not been registered with Indonesian Stock Exchange, so that they shall not obliged to announce their financial statement. The management of KOMUNIKA is very reclusive towards outsiders and rejected to disclose its financial condition. We observed that total sales turnover of the company in 2008 amounted to Rp. 25.0 billion rose to Rp. 28.0 billion in 2009 increased to Rp. 31.0 billion in 2010 and projected to go on rising by at least 5% in 2011. The operation in 2010 yielded an estimated net profit of at least Rp. 2.8 billion and the company has an estimated total networth of at least Rp. 2.0 billion. So far, we did not heard that the company having been black listed by the Central Bank (Bank Indonesia). The company usually pays its debts punctually to suppliers.  

 

The management of KOMUNIKA is led by Mr. Mohammad Farukh Suleiman (50) a professional manager with experienced in trading, import and authorized distribution of Huawei Tech Mobile Cellular Phone, cooperative and other business. The company's management is handled by professional staff in the above business. They have wide relations with private businessmen within and outside the country. So far, we did not hear that the management of the company being filed to the district court for detrimental cases or involved in any business malpractices. The company’s litigation record is clean and it has not registered with the black list of Bank of Indonesia. KOPERASI KARYAWAN MITRA USAHA DINAMIKA or abbreviated KOMUNIKA is sufficiently fairly good for business transaction.
